BHEL wins Rs 240 cr contract in Gujarat

New Delhi, Nov 24 (UNI) Bharat Heavy Electricals Limited (BHEL) has bagged a Rs 240 crore contract from a Tata Power company in Gujarat.

The contract has been placed on BHEL by Coastal Gujarat Power Limited for their upcoming 4,000 MW (5x800 MW) Utra Mega Ppower Project (UMPP) at Mundra, a BHEL spokesman told UNI today.

It's the largest-ever contract for the manufacture and supply of power transformers and busducts.

The order for 40 transformers with a cumulative capacity of 5,872 MVA includes five sets of India's highest rating 930 MVA, three phase transformer banks.

The order for busducts is also the first order in the country for 800 MW thermal sets.

While the generator transformers for the first unit will have to be delivered by February 2010, supplies for the fifth unit will be completed by June 2011, the spokesman said.
